[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
1104261
1127348
1404122
1404487
1404567
1615608
1 664 900
3AF807441GRU
41002993156
41627332423
or
Post Buying Request
Suppliers
BOSCH
9 432 610 743
Find The OE Number:
16620 01D02
NP-DLLA153SN786